Question: Is Ginger British?

In British English, the word ginger is sometimes used to describe red-headed people (at times in an insulting manner), with terms such as gingerphobia and gingerism used by the British media. In Britain, redheads are also sometimes referred to disparagingly as carrot tops and carrot heads.

What nationality is a ginger?

Red hair has long been associated with Celtic people. Both the ancient Greeks and Romans described the Celts as redheads. The Romans extended the description to Germanic people, at least those they most frequently encountered in southern and western Germany. It still holds true today.

What the British mean when they call someone a ginger?

Be careful describing somebody as a bit ginger or a ginger in the UK - particularly in London. Ginger or Ginger Beer is rhyming slang for queer or homosexual.

What does Ginger mean in Africa?

To ginger someone in Lagos slang means to make someone feel good or to spice them up.
